Aso Rock Deserted As President Tinubu, VP Shettima Depart For Paris And Dakar

As the President and Vice President embark on their international engagements, Nigerians are left wondering about the implications of this abrupt shift.

President Tinubu and VP Shettima have departed for Paris and Dakar, respectively, for official business.

 

NewsOnline Nigeria reports that in an unexpected turn of events, Aso Rock, the seat of Nigeria’s government, stands eerily deserted as both President Bola Ahmed Tinubu and Vice President Kashim Shettima have left the country for official visits to Paris and Dakar. The sudden absence of the country’s top leaders has left many questioning the stability and continuity of the Nigerian government during their departure.

 

This Nigeria news platform gathered that Vice President Senator Kashim Shettima departed Abuja for Dakar, Senegal, to represent President Bola Tinubu at the country’s 65th Independence Day Anniversary celebrations.

Senegal celebrates its Independence Day on April 4 each year, commemorating its freedom from French colonial rule in 1960. The day is marked by national pride, with ceremonies, parades and cultural events.

 

According to a statement by his spokesman, Stanley Nkwocha, the Vice President’s attendance at the annual event is in honour of an invitation extended to President Tinubu by the Senegalese President, Bassirou Diomaye Faye, following the strong mutual relationship between Nigeria and Senegal.

 

The Independence Day celebrations will be held at the Place de la Nation in Dakar, with President Faye playing host to Vice President Shettima and other distinguished guests from across Africa and beyond.

 

The Vice President is expected to return to Nigeria tomorrow after the one-day event.

 

NewsOnline Nigeria recalls that President Tinubu had on Wednesday departed Abuja for France for a two-week working visit.

As the President and Vice President embark on their international engagements, Nigerians are left wondering about the implications of this abrupt shift. Will the government maintain its usual operations, or is the country facing a moment of uncertainty? The silence from Aso Rock is deafening as many await further updates.
